Right on, thanks for asking...

It's a Warmoth roasted swamp ash body with a Warmoth maple and ebony neck..32". It's got Bartolini pickups now and what I think are nickel strings. It weighs about 7.5 lbs and is a joy to play for 4 hour gigs... I am a 32" convert.
